
Why Compliance Fatigue Is a National Security Risk

The episode discusses the risks of compliance fatigue and the importance of collaboration in cybersecurity.
Compliance shouldn’t come at the cost of security. In this episode, Leah McGrath (Executive Director, GovRAMP) and Brian Conrad (Director of Global Strategic Compliance Initiatives at Zscaler, formerly of FedRAMP) join the Trust vs. team to talk about multi-framework fatigue, the future of recognition and reciprocity, and why real cybersecurity progress depends on collaboration—not just more certifications. Hosted by HITRUST’s Ryan Patrick and Jeremy Huval, this episode dives deep into how public and private sectors can work together to reduce redundancy and get back to the real work: protecting critical systems and data.
